Title: USS Madawaska (ID # 3011)
Description: At the Norfolk Navy Yard, Virginia, 19 February 1919. Panoramic photograph, taken by the G.L. Hall Optical Co., Norfolk, Va. Note Navy Yard railway crane in the right center foreground, with two very large crates beyond. Madawaska is still wearing World War I dazzle camouflage, more than three months after the Armistice. Most of the clutter seen in the upper part of the image is the coaling gear and other upperworks of a Navy collier tied up off Madawaska's opposite (port) side. Donation of the Norfolk Naval Shipyard Museum, Portsmouth, Virginia. U.S. Naval History and Heritage Command Photograph.
